ICD-9-CM 998.12 is a billable medical code that can be used to indicate a diagnosis on a reimbursement claim, however, 998.12 should only be used for claims with a date of service on or before September 30, 2015.
WebMar 22, 2024 · Code K66.1, Hemoperitoneum (Hematoperitoneum), qualifies as an MCC as a secondary diagnosis. As the principal diagnosis, it leads to DRG 395-Other Digestive System Diagnoses without CC/MCC with a geometric length of stay (GMLOS) of 2.4 and a relative weight (RW) of 0.6746. Hematoma produces elevation and discoloration of the wound edges, discomfort, and swelling. Blood sometimes leaks between skin sutures. You'll likely need no other tests. If you have recurrent subconjunctival hemorrhages, your doctor may also: Ask you questions about your general health and symptoms. Conduct an eye examination. If it is Traumatic, then see S30.0 _ _ _ for Deep Contusion of the Abdomen/Abdominal wall. If it is Not Traumatic, but spontaneous, then see M79.81: Non-traumatic Hematoma of Soft-tissue or Muscle.
